Buying Guide: How to Choose the Right Bathroom Towel Bar Shelf

What is your space type?

Consider whether you need wall-mounted shelves in a powder room, a guest bath, or a master bathroom. Vertical storage or over-the-toilet designs help maximize small footprints, while floating shelves produce open, accessible surfaces for everyday items.

How much weight will you store?

Check the weight capacity of the shelves. Models featuring solid wood boards and powder-coated metal brackets typically support more items, including towels, toiletries, and small decor. If you have heavy items, prioritize higher capacity shelves with robust brackets.

Detachable vs. fixed towel bars

Detachable towel bars offer flexibility for different layouts or room configurations. If you want a minimalist look, choose a model where the bar can be removed easily. If you regularly hang towels, a fixed or easily accessible bar may be more convenient.

Material durability and care

Look for solid wood with protective finishes and rust-resistant metal components for bathroom humidity. Durable finishes help resist moisture, warping, and corrosion, ensuring long-term use in damp environments.

Finish and style considerations

Choose a finish that complements your bathroom style. Light, natural wood tones pair with airy spaces, while dark finishes or black hardware work well with modern, bold palettes. Consistency with existing fixtures helps create a cohesive look.

Installation practicality

Consider how you will mount the shelves. Some options are drill-free with adhesive or glue methods, while others require screws into studs. For renters or walls with delicate surfaces, drill-free methods may be preferable, though heavy items may necessitate drilling for stability.

Multi-room versatility

If you want a single set of shelves to work across bathrooms, kitchens, living rooms, and bedrooms, prioritize models described as suitable for multiple spaces and with versatile configurations, such as removable towel bars and modular shelf heights.

FAQ

  1. Are towel bar shelves easy to install?

    Yes. Many models come with simple mounting hardware and clear instructions. Some offer drill-free installation options, while others require screws into studs for maximum stability.

  2. What materials are best for bathrooms with high humidity?

    Solid wood with protective finishes and rust-resistant metal frames perform well. The combination reduces warping and corrosion in damp environments.

  3. Can I use these shelves in other rooms besides the bathroom?

    Absolutely. Floating shelves with towel bars can store towels, plants, books, or decor in kitchens, living rooms, bedrooms, and entryways.

  4. Do these shelves support heavy bathroom items?

    Most featured models support around 20+ pounds on the shelf surface, with the towel bar carrying towels or clothing. Always verify the specified weight limit for your chosen model.

  5. Should the towel bar be installed under the shelf or in a separate position?

    This depends on your space and use case. Installing under the shelf saves counter space, while placing it separately can optimize towel reach in cramped layouts.

  6. What maintenance helps extend shelf life?

    Regular cleaning to remove moisture, inspecting mounting hardware, and ensuring screws remain tight helps maintain stability and longevity in humid bathrooms.
